Are iMessages and text messages the same?

iMessages are in blue and text messages are green. iMessages only work between iPhones (and other Apple devices such as iPads). If you are using an iPhone and you send a message to a friend on Android, it will be sent as a SMS message and will be green.

Why did my message send as a text and not iMessage?

Any text to someone else, such as an individual with an Android phone, will be sent as a text message by default. If you elect to turn off iMessage completely, then every message you send from your device will be sent as a text message instead.

What does it mean when your iMessage goes from blue to green?

Short answer: Blue ones have been sent or received using Apple’s iMessage technology, while green ones are “traditional” text messages exchanged via Short Messaging Service, or SMS.

Will an iMessage send as a text if blocked?

The message sends as normal, and you don’t get an error message. This is no help at all for clues. If you have an iPhone and try to send an iMessage to someone who has blocked you, it will remain blue (which means it’s still an iMessage). However, the person you’ve been blocked by will never receive that message.

How is iMessage different from normal text messages?

iMessages use the Internet. The main difference between iMessages and text messages is how they send data. Text messages use your cell connection, bouncing from cell tower to cell tower. Meanwhile, iMessages transfer data using the Internet.
